Kedzie–Homan station
Chicago "L" station From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Remove ads
Kedzie–Homan is an 'L' station on the CTA Blue Line's Forest Park branch. The station is located in the median of the Eisenhower Expressway and serving the East Garfield Park neighborhood and has two entrances on the Kedzie and Homan Avenue overpasses.

Expressway-median station

Kedzie–Homan was named Kedzie until the early 1990s, when the name was changed to Kedzie–Homan. However, signs on the platform still referred to the station as Kedzie until 2013, when signs with Kedzie-Homan were installed.[citation needed]
In 2000–2001, Kedzie–Homan was renovated with a number of improvements for $2.6 million. The improvements included making the station handicapped accessible by modifying the entrance ramps, brighter lighting, new doors, and a redesigned entryway to improve passenger flow.[2]
